Forecast: Wages and Salaries in Manufacture of Weapons and Ammunition Sector in Brazil

In 2023, the wages and salaries in the manufacture of weapons and ammunition sector in Brazil stood at 529.50 million Brazilian Reals. The forecasted data points to a steady upward trend from 2024 to 2028, with the value incrementally increasing each year. Specifically, the sector is projected to grow by 1.43% in 2025, followed by 1.38% in 2026, 1.34% in 2027, and 1.29% in 2028. Over the five-year period from 2024 to 2028, the compound annual growth rate (CAGR) is expected to be around 1.36%.
